147 /*
148  * Determine whether a filesystem should be checked.
149  */
150 docheck(fsp)
151 	register struct fstab *fsp;
152 {
153 
154 	if (strcmp(fsp->fs_vfstype, "ufs") ||
155 	    (strcmp(fsp->fs_type, FSTAB_RW) &&
156 	     strcmp(fsp->fs_type, FSTAB_RO)) ||
157 	    fsp->fs_passno == 0)
158 		return (0);
159 	return (1);
160 }

162 /*
163  * Check the specified filesystem.
164  */
165 /* ARGSUSED */
166 checkfilesys(filesys, mntpt, auxdata, child)
167 	char *filesys, *mntpt;
168 	long auxdata;
169 {
170 	daddr_t n_ffree, n_bfree;
171 	struct dups *dp;
172 	struct zlncnt *zlnp;
173 	int clean;
174 
175 	if (preen && child)
176 		(void)signal(SIGQUIT, voidquit);
177 	devname = filesys;
178 	if (debug && preen)
179 		pwarn("starting\n");
180 	if (setup(filesys) == 0) {
181 		if (preen)
182 			pfatal("CAN'T CHECK FILE SYSTEM.");
183 		return (0);
184 	}
185 
186 	/*
187 	 * 0: check whether file system is already clean
188 	 */
189 	clean = preen && (sblock.fs_state == FSOKAY) && sblock.fs_clean;
190 
191 #ifdef notyet
192 	if (clean) {
193 #else
194 	if (0) {
195 #endif
196 		printf("** filesystem clean -- skipping checks\n");
197 	} else {
198 		/*
199 		 * 1: scan inodes tallying blocks used
200 		 */
201 		if (preen == 0) {
202 			printf("** Last Mounted on %s\n", sblock.fs_fsmnt);
203 			if (hotroot)
204 				printf("** Root file system\n");
205 			printf("** Phase 1 - Check Blocks and Sizes\n");
206 		}
207 		pass1();
208 
209 		/*
210 		 * 1b: locate first references to duplicates, if any
211 		 */
212 		if (duplist) {
213 			if (preen)
214 				pfatal("INTERNAL ERROR: dups with -p");
215 			printf("** Phase 1b - Rescan For More DUPS\n");
216 			pass1b();
217 		}
218 
219 		/*
220 		 * 2: traverse directories from root to mark all connected
221 		 * directories
222 		 */
223 		if (preen == 0)
224 			printf("** Phase 2 - Check Pathnames\n");
225 		pass2();
226 
227 		/*
228 		 * 3: scan inodes looking for disconnected directories
229 		 */
230 		if (preen == 0)
231 			printf("** Phase 3 - Check Connectivity\n");
232 		pass3();
233 
234 		/*
235 		 * 4: scan inodes looking for disconnected files; check
236 		 * reference counts
237 		 */
238 		if (preen == 0)
239 			printf("** Phase 4 - Check Reference Counts\n");
240 		pass4();
241 
242 		/*
243 		 * 5: check and repair resource counts in cylinder groups
244 		 */
245 		if (preen == 0)
246 			printf("** Phase 5 - Check Cyl groups\n");
247 		pass5();
248 	}
